Buy meat by whatever's cheapest by the pound, usually chicken. Then get the cheaper cuts, hell, buy the whole bird and butcher it when you get home, seal it up and put it in the freezer. Buy everything in bulk, a 10 lb sack of oats is way cheaper per pound than buying individual packs or 1 lb tubes. Also coupons are your friends. Look up frugal living youtube channels.
